**CI note: Greenbroom stale-branch bot**

Greenbroom deletes branches with no commits in 60 days. If your branch vanished, it's recoverable for 14 days via the archive namespace. The bot skips anything labeled keep-alive. If it deletes something it shouldn't have, check the exclusion list in the Greenbroom config first. Every cleanup run logs the token below.

session token of tajef-bageg = htk21_5d90d574934f3ccae6437

Q: Why does the Moonskiff tide-table widget sometimes show stale data?

A: The widget caches predictions for six hours per station. If a station's upstream model is re-run, the cache isn't invalidated automatically, so readings can lag. Manual cache purges and the refresh schedule are documented on the internal page below.

wiki page, tahaf-tajog: https://jira.ordindyn.corp/pipeline

Subject: Proctoring queue handover

Future maintainers: the Oakenshaw exam-proctoring queue drains into `proctor_events` every 30s. If the dead-letter count climbs past 200, restart the consumer — don't purge. Session flags are rebuilt nightly, so duplicate events are harmless. Schema changes require sign-off because the scoring job at Fennick Academy reads the same tables. The queue's backing database is reached with the connection string below.

warehouse DSN: mssql://rusdor_svc:0FSWCn9@db-951a.paliqforge.local:5432/ulawyn

14:22 — Offline sync regression confirmed (Terrapath field-survey app)

At 14:22 the on-call engineer reproduced the data-loss path: surveys saved while offline were marked synced once connectivity returned, even when the upload was rejected. The queue flush skipped the server acknowledgement check introduced in the previous sprint. Release manager note: the fix must ship before the coastal survey season. The offending build is identified by the token recorded below.

session token of kawif-fawig = htk31_f3f599be2b1a34affb1efa8d0feccf8